Dr. Brian McGrath performs 1st outpatient hip replacement at Southtowns Surgery Center — 5 insights

Buffalo, N.Y.-based UBMD Orthopaedics & Sports Medicine orthopedic surgeon Brian McGrath, MD, performed the first hip replacement at Orchard Park, N.Y.-based Southtowns Surgery Center.

Here’s what you should know:

1. UBMD’s Geoffrey Bernas, MD, and Jeremy Doak, MD, will also perform hip arthroscopy at Southtowns Surgery Center.

2. UBMD physicians will begin performing other joint replacements as well as spine surgery at the center within six months.

3. Sports medicine surgeons already perform minimally invasive arthroscopic surgery at the center.

4. Dr. McGrath said in a release, “The Southtowns Surgery Center is great for our surgeons and patients because everything we need is under one roof. From in-office visits, imaging, surgery, and physical therapy — we have it all here.”

5. Southtowns Surgery Center is a Buffalo, N.Y.-based Kaleida Health affiliate.
